What Are Double Glazing Windows?

Double glazing windows include 2 panes of glass separated by a space filled with air or gas (commonly argon, krypton, or xenon). This building and construction develops an insulating barrier that reduces heat transfer, making homes warmer in winter and cooler in summertime. In addition, the air or gas within the panes even more enhances insulation, reducing sound contamination and increasing security.

Types of Double Glazing Windows

Double glazing windows been available in various styles and products. Here are the most typical types:

TypeDescription
uPVC WindowsMade from un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, these windows are resilient, low upkeep, and energy-efficient. They are available in different colors and designs.
Aluminium WindowsStrong and light-weight, aluminium windows are understood for their sleek look and long life expectancy. They can offer better views due to narrower frames.
Wooden WindowsConventional wood frames supply aesthetic appeal and good insulation however need routine maintenance to avoid decay.
Composite WindowsThese windows integrate materials like wood and aluminium, using the advantages of both aesthetic appeals and durability.

Setup Considerations

Before choosing to set up double glazing windows, property owners must keep the following considerations in mind:

1. Cost

  • Double glazing can be more pricey than single glazing; however, the long-lasting cost savings on energy costs can balance out the preliminary investment.

2. Existing Windows

  • Examine whether your existing window frames can accommodate double glazing. Older frames might require to be replaced or strengthened.

3. Building Regulations

  • Check local structure codes and guidelines, as specific locations may have restrictions on window types or insulation scores.

4. Professional Installation

  • Engaging an expert installer is important to ensure the windows are fitted correctly, maximizing their energy effectiveness and aesthetic appeal.

5. Frame Material

  • Select the right frame product according to your budget plan, choices, and the existing architectural design of your home.
